Abstract

The invention discloses a cerebral apoplexy early-stage image evaluation system and a cerebral blood supply region template image evaluation method, which are used for storing more than two cerebral blood supply region template images, wherein the cerebral blood supply region template images can be decomposed into a mean template image and a standard deviation template image; during pretreatment, preserving brain parenchymal tissues in the flat scanning CT image; performing silhouette calculation on the brain blood supply region template image and the preprocessed flat scan CT image to obtain a difference image, and comparing the difference image with the standard deviation template image; blood supply area assessment module: scoring the image condition of the blood supply region segment in the flat scan CT image according to the pixel value of the pixel point obtained by comparing the difference image with the standard deviation template image; comprehensive scoring: the grading of blood supply area segments and the comprehensive grading of the multiple physiological index data levels of human bodies are carried out. According to the invention, the risk of cerebral apoplexy and even the severity of cerebral apoplexy can be accurately estimated by grading the difference level of the pixel values of the comparison of the estimated image and the template image and grading the data level of multiple physiological indexes of human bodies.

Background
"cerebral stroke" (also known as "stroke", "cerebrovascular accident" (cerebralvascular accident, CVA)) is an acute cerebrovascular disease, which is a group of diseases that cause damage to brain tissue due to sudden rupture of cerebral vessels or failure of blood to flow into the brain due to vessel occlusion, including ischemic and hemorrhagic strokes. The cerebral apoplexy has the characteristics of high morbidity, high mortality and high disability rate. Prevention is currently considered the best measure because of the continued lack of effective treatment. Early diagnosis, early treatment, early recovery and early prevention recurrence are all effective approaches to avoid/reduce stroke damage. However, the prior art is time-consuming and laborious and does not evaluate the actual condition of the cerebral stroke accurately enough.
Disclosure of Invention
The invention aims to provide a cerebral apoplexy early-stage image evaluation system and method, which are used for accurately evaluating the actual condition of cerebral apoplexy and providing a technical basis for effectively carrying out early diagnosis, early treatment, early rehabilitation and early prevention recurrence.
In order to achieve the above purpose, the invention adopts the following technical scheme:
an early cerebral apoplexy image evaluation system,
comprising the following steps:
and a storage module: storing more than two brain blood supply area template images, wherein the brain blood supply area template images comprise corresponding age ranges, shooting parameters and brain blood supply area template images with different basic diseases;
the brain blood supply area template image is obtained by importing brain blood supply area images with different age ranges, shooting parameters and basic diseases, carrying out pixel analysis, calculating the mean value and variance of pixel values of pixel points at corresponding positions, and then defining the mean value and variance to corresponding pixel points on a standard image to obtain the brain blood supply area template image, wherein the brain blood supply area template image can be decomposed into a mean value template image and a standard deviation template image;
and a pretreatment module: removing skull in the flat scan CT image, and reserving brain parenchyma tissue;
and an image analysis module: comparing the brain blood supply area template image with the preprocessed flat scan CT image, identifying a blood supply area in the flat scan CT image, automatically acquiring the position of the blood supply area in the brain according to a corresponding brain map, performing silhouette calculation on the brain blood supply area template image and the preprocessed flat scan CT image to obtain a difference image, and comparing the difference image with the standard deviation template image;
blood supply area assessment module: scoring the image condition of the blood supply region segment in the flat scan CT image according to the pixel value of the pixel point obtained by comparing the difference image with the standard deviation template image;
comprehensive scoring: the scores of the blood supply area segments are comprehensively scored.
Further, the method comprises the steps of,
the comprehensive score also comprises a plurality of human body physiological index data scores, wherein the physiological indexes comprise blood pressure, blood sugar, blood fat and body temperature.
An evaluation method using a cerebral apoplexy early-stage image evaluation system, comprising the steps of:
the first step: removing skull in the flat scan CT image, and reserving brain parenchyma tissue;
and a second step of: comparing the brain blood supply area template image with the preprocessed flat scan CT image, identifying a blood supply area in the flat scan CT image, automatically acquiring the position of the blood supply area in the brain according to a corresponding brain map, performing silhouette calculation on the brain blood supply area template image and the preprocessed flat scan CT image to obtain a difference image, and comparing the difference image with the standard deviation template image;
and a third step of: according to the pixel value of the pixel point obtained by comparing the difference image with the standard deviation template image, when the absolute value of the pixel value exceeds 1-3 times of the pixel value of the corresponding pixel point of the standard deviation template image, grading the image condition of the blood supply area segment in the flat scanning CT image into three grades;
fourth step: the scores of the blood supply area segments are comprehensively scored.
Preferably, the method comprises the steps of,
and scoring the image condition of the blood supply region segment in the flat scan CT image, wherein the scoring rule is the pixel value of the pixel point obtained by comparing the difference image with the standard deviation template image, and when the absolute value of the pixel value exceeds 1-3 times of the pixel value of the corresponding pixel point of the standard deviation template image, the image condition of the blood supply region segment in the flat scan CT image is scored in three grades.
Preferably, the method comprises the steps of,
the fourth step further comprises grading the multiple physiological index data of the human body, wherein grading is carried out on the multiple physiological index data of the human body according to whether the multiple physiological index data of the human body is in a normal index range, one grade is lower than the normal index range, one grade is in the normal index range, and one grade is higher than the normal index range.
The advantages of the invention include:
(1) The difference of the evaluation image can be known by comparing the image to be evaluated with the template image;
(2) By grading the difference level of the pixel values of the comparison of the evaluation image and the template image and grading the data level of multiple physiological indexes of the human body, the risk of cerebral apoplexy and even the severity of cerebral apoplexy can be accurately evaluated.
